    Default Re: Bushcraft gun - what would/do you choose/use?

    Quote Originally Posted by buccaneer View Post
    I think if you have a 22lr 12ga and a 308 win you could live a life time in the bush and you shouldn't go hungry to often.
    While I agree that these are very versatile choices, I fail to see why you need a shotgun if feeding yourself is the only objective. Wing shooting is a very inefficient way of procuring protein. For birds and small game, when sport is not the objective, the 22lr will be much more efficient.
